What Qualifications Should I Look for in a General Contractor?

When choosing a construction contractor, one should focus on essential criteria such as appropriate licensing, adequate insurance, a solid portfolio of previous work, excellent references, and strong communication skills to guarantee a successful remodeling project.

What Should I Include in the Contract With My General Contractor?

The contract established with a general contractor should include project scope, payment schedules, timelines, materials specifications, warranties, and conflict resolution procedures. Clearly communicating expectations guarantees alignment and reduces potential misunderstandings throughout the renovation process.

How Can I Verify a Contractor's References and Past Work?

To verify a contractor's work history and references, you should contact previous clients, obtain photos of completed projects, and check online reviews. Furthermore, viewing completed work can offer direct insight into the contractor's workmanship and dependability.
